The effects of the electron-phonon interaction on a Mott insulator

Academic Article
Publication Date:
2004
abstract:
Using the dynamical mean field theory we show that an electron - phonon interaction can revert the energetic balance between the metallic state and the Mott insulator in the density-driven metal-insulator transition at zero temperature. We present results for the Hubbard - Holstein model where the Mott ground state is found for sufficiently high values of the electron - phonon coupling but still not in the polaronic regime.
